Interactive Live Cooking Station Ideas For Unforgettable Dining Experiences

Transforming a standard meal into an event starts with the presentation, and nothing achieves this more effectively than a live cooking station. Whether you are hosting an intimate dinner party, a corporate gala, or a bustling wedding reception, the sight of a chef creating dishes to order generates a unique energy. This approach turns the kitchen from a hidden room into the vibrant heart of the event, offering a dynamic solution for modern hospitality.

Defining the Live Cooking Experience

A live cooking station is more than just food service; it is a form of culinary theater. It involves setting up a fully functional kitchen zone where dishes are prepared in front of guests. This interaction creates a sense of exclusivity and freshness that is difficult to replicate with traditional buffet or plated services. The concept caters to an audience that values both entertainment and gastronomy, making the dining experience multi-sensory and memorable.

Strategic Layout and Space Planning

The success of any live cooking station hinges on its layout. You must consider the flow of traffic, the safety of the crew, and the visibility for the audience. The station should be an open loop or U-shape, allowing guests to move smoothly forward without bottlenecking. Ideally, the setup includes distinct zones for cold appetizers, main cooking action, and final plating to ensure the line moves efficiently from start to finish.

Essential Station Components

To function properly, a live station requires specific infrastructure. You need robust refrigeration to keep ingredients fresh, high-powered induction tops or griddles for consistent heat, and ample lighting to showcase the food. Additionally, the area must have proper ventilation and safety barriers to protect both the chef and the guests from the heat and splatter of active cooking.

Station Type Best For Key Equipment
Gourmet Burger Casual, interactive events Flat top grill, ingredient caddies
Pasta Station Elegant dinners Copper pots, rapid chillers
Sushi/Sashimi Intimate receptions Sushi display cases, ice baths

Menu Engineering for Performance

Not every dish is suitable for a live station. The ideal menu items are visually impressive, have a short cook time, and can be customized on the spot. Dishes like stone-grilled steaks, fresh salads with theatrical flair, or molten chocolate desserts are popular choices. The goal is to select food that highlights the skill of the chef while keeping the wait times manageable for the queue.

Enhancing Guest Interaction

The true magic of a live station happens through conversation. Guests appreciate the ability to interact with the chef, ask questions about ingredients, and request modifications. The culinary professional can act as a host, guiding guests through the options and making suggestions. This personal touch elevates the service from mere consumption to a curated experience, leaving a lasting impression on every attendee.

Logistics and Vendor Coordination

Implementing a live station requires meticulous planning behind the scenes. You must ensure a reliable power source, adequate water supply, and efficient waste management. Coordination with the catering team is vital to sync the pacing of the food with the event schedule. Investing in a professional company that specializes in mobile kitchens ensures that the equipment is reliable and the staff is trained to deliver a seamless performance.
